WATKINS v. GROSS

No. 54888.

772 S.W.2d 22 (1989)

Marjorie WATKINS, Plaintiff-Appellant, v. Abe GROSS, Defendant-Respondent.

Missouri Court of Appeals, Eastern District, Division Four.

June 27, 1989.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Fred Roth, Clayton, for plaintiff-appellant.

Richard J. Boardman, Neil Bruntrager, Mary B. Schroeder, St. Louis, for defendant-respondent.


SMITH, Presiding Judge.

Plaintiff appeals from a judgment notwithstanding the verdict in favor of defendant in this case based upon fraud. We affirm.

Defendant was the owner of real estate in the City of St. Louis which throughout his ownership of 12 or more years, and previously, had been utilized as a tavern and restaurant.
